As part of our learning in literacy, Huia Whanau have been focusing on the anatomy of the human body. We've previously been learning about the skeletal system and the structure of our bones. We did a simple science experiment to help our understanding around the different layers of human bone.
We started by researching the difference between calcium and calcium carbonate. We learnt that calcium is a product that makes the outer layer of our bones strong, and we commonly get it from food sources such dairy products and seeds. We then learnt calcium carbonate is a compound product, meaning it is made up of two ingredients, much like compound word or a compound sentence. Calcium carbonate is 60% calcium and 40% carbonate, which is a chalk-like substance we get from rocks such as limestone.
Calcium carbonate is a product that people take if their diet is lacking in calcium. This helps them to make sure they are getting enough calcium. However, overuse over a long period of time, can cause damage to the kidney - this is because the added carbonate isn't healthy for human consumption.
We learnt that egg shells are similar to human bones, and made from calcium carbonate. Like human bones, the outer layer is strong and designed to protect. Also like the human bone, the inner layer acts as a sponge. We submerged our raw eggs in a glass jar filled with white vinegar. We then left them sitting for 4 days. Over the 4 days, we saw some changes in our eggs as the outer layer was no longer protecting the egg, and the second layer was beginning to soak up the vinegar. Our eggs lost their brownish colour, grew in size, and began to sink to the bottom of the jar.
After the final day, we removed our eggs and took them to the top court to see if they would bounce. Some eggs broke as soon as they were pulled from the jar, while others were successful in bouncing. Those that were successful, however, only bounced a few times before breaking as well.
